SoWa Open Market

At the end of Thayer Street: 455 Harrison Avenue

This baby started the trend. A sunny Sunday morning in June, a sea of white tents … and lots and lots of kids just out of art school flapping their wings, offering you everything from found-glass anklets to toaster sculpture to pastel knit caps made of cotton and silk for your first-born. Next to moms-and-pops who’ve survived the aftermath of the 70’s unphased and are still carving their salad bowls from swamp cedar. Seconded by the cleverest fridge magnets, yes hand-made, you ever did see including some that hide in the freezer when mom and dad come to visit. If you come out of here without something to slide across the table on your second date, to give to your favorite thinking man’s groom, or to get you out of your latest tight … then you should give up and start parsing a West Elm catalog.
